CALENDAR SPREAD -1 $133 CALL 10/28 +1 $133 CALL 11/04 Approx. cost: $0.85. I have a hunch that FB's earnings will be surprisingly positive. But that doesn't mean the stock will shoot up by a double-digit percentage. I'm thinking it just means it won't fall. If the stock does shoot way up or way down, a calendar spread can only lose the original debit. Plus,...

$OUT (ad space REIT) This trade involves selling a put and using the credit from the short put to buy a long call. +1 $20 CALL 3/17/23. ---{share price $15.94}--- -1 $12.5 PUT 3/17/23. $10 credit at order. Requires $1,250 collateral for the short put.
$MPW. Bullish, 'bottom-is-in' trade idea. +1 $11 CALL 1/20/23. ---{current share price: $10.25}--- -1 $9 PUT 1/20/23. Short put accommodates an add'l 12% of downside. Long call profit starts kicking in at 7% . Order can be filled for a credit of $0.05. $900 collateral needed for short put.

"Financed Spread" idea. 12/16 Expiration. Bullish, or 'bottom-is-in' trade. The idea is to sell a short put and use the credit from the short put to cover the debit of a bullish call spread. Sell(-) $47.5 Call 12/16. Buy(+) $45 Call 12/16. --{Current Share Price: $43}-- Sell(-) $35 Put 12/16. The credit will be around $80 and the collateral will be $3500. The...
"Financed Spread" idea. 1/20/23 Expiration. SELL $50 Call. BUY $45 Call. --{Current Share Price: $42}-- SELL $40 Put. The credit will be around $166 and the collateral will be $4,000. The max gain of $666 hits at a share price of $50 (19% price gain from current (10/1) price).
